Răsfoiți Sursa

Updated bills filtrts

Samson Mutunga 3 ani în urmă
părinte
comite
7ba4faa119

+ 2 - 2
app/Http/Controllers/DnaController.php

@@ -126,7 +126,7 @@ class DnaController extends Controller
         $bills = Bill::where(function($q) use ($performerProID){
             return $q->where('na_pro_id', '=', $performerProID )->orWhere('generic_pro_id', '=', $performerProID);
         });
-        $this->filterMultiQuery($request, $bills, 'created_at', 'date_category', 'date_value_1', 'date_value_2');
+        $this->filterMultiQuery($request, $bills, 'effective_date', 'date_category', 'date_value_1', 'date_value_2');
         $this->filterMultiQuery($request, $bills, 'na_expected_payment_amount', 'amount_category', 'amount_value_1', 'amount_value_2');
         
         $status = $request->get('status');
@@ -144,7 +144,7 @@ class DnaController extends Controller
     public function myClinicalTeams(Request $request){
         $filters = $request->all();
         $teams = ProTeam::where('assistant_pro_id', $this->performer->pro->id);        
-        $teams = $teams->orderBy('created_at', 'DESC')->paginate(20);
+        $teams = $teams->orderBy('effective_date', 'DESC')->paginate(20);
         return view('app.dna.my-clinical-teams', compact('teams', 'filters'));
     }
 

+ 7 - 9
resources/views/app/dna/my-bills.blade.php

@@ -7,14 +7,12 @@
         <div class="card-header px-3 py-2 d-flex align-items-center">
             <strong class="mr-4">
                 <i class="fas fa-calendar-alt"></i>
-                My Bills 
-
-                <div class=" d-flex align-items-center">
-                    <?php $entityType = null; ?>
-                    @include('app.generic-bills.create_generic-bill')
-                </div>
-
+                My Bills
             </strong>
+            <div class=" d-flex align-items-center">
+                <?php $entityType = null; ?>
+                @include('app.generic-bills.create_generic-bill')
+            </div>
         </div>
 
         <div class="card-body p-0">
@@ -24,7 +22,7 @@
             <table class="table table-sm table-striped p-0 m-0">
                 <thead class="bg-light border-top">
                     <tr>
-                        <th class="border-0">Date</th>
+                        <th class="border-0">Effective Date</th>
                         <th class="border-0">Patient</th>
                         <th class="border-0">Service</th>
                         <th class="border-0">Description</th>
@@ -37,7 +35,7 @@
                 <tbody>
                     @foreach($bills as $bill)
                     <tr>
-                        <td>{{ friendly_date($bill->created_at) }}</td>
+                        <td>{{ friendly_date($bill->effective_date) }}</td>
                        
                         <td>
                             @if($bill->client)

+ 2 - 2
resources/views/app/dna/my_bills_filters.blade.php

@@ -54,10 +54,10 @@
 			</select>
 			<div v-show="filters.amount_category" class="mt-2">
 				<div>
-					<input  name="amount_value_1" v-model="filters.amount_value_1" type="date" class="form-control input-sm"/>
+					<input  name="amount_value_1" v-model="filters.amount_value_1" type="number" class="form-control input-sm"/>
 				</div>
 				<div v-show="filters.amount_category === 'BETWEEN' || filters.amount_category === 'NOT_BETWEEN'" class="mt-2">
-					<input name="amount_value_2" v-model="filters.amount_value_2" type="date" class="form-control input-sm"/>
+					<input name="amount_value_2" v-model="filters.amount_value_2" type="number" class="form-control input-sm"/>
 				</div>
 			</div>
 		</div>